Lexical Alignment and Communicative Success in Autism Spectrum Disorder.

机构信息

Department of Psychological Sciences, University of Connecticut, Storrs.

出版信息

J Speech Lang Hear Res. 2022 Nov 17;65(11):4300-4305. doi: 10.1044/2022_JSLHR-22-00314. Epub 2022 Oct 19.

Abstract

PURPOSE

Typical speakers tend to adopt words used by their conversational partners. This "lexical alignment" enhances communication by reducing ambiguity and promoting a shared understanding of the topic under discussion. Lexical alignment has been little studied to date in autism spectrum disorder (ASD); furthermore, it has been studied primarily via structured laboratory tasks that may overestimate performance. This study examined lexical alignment in ASD during discourse and explored associations with communicative success and executive function.

METHOD

Thirty-one autistic and nonautistic adolescents were paired with a study-naïve research assistant (RA) to complete a social communication task that involved taking turns verbally instructing (guiding) the partner to navigate on a map. Lexical alignment was operationalized as the proportion of shared vocabulary produced by guides on successive maps. Task accuracy was operationalized as the pixels contained within the intended and drawn routes.

RESULTS

Results indicated that autistic adolescents had greater difficulty describing navigational routes to RAs, yielding paths that were less accurate. Alignment was reduced in autistic participants, and it was associated with path accuracy for nonautistic, but not autistic, adolescents. The association between lexical alignment and executive function missed significance ( = .05); if significant, the association would indicate that greater executive function difficulty was associated with reduced lexical alignment.

CONCLUSIONS

These findings provide preliminary evidence of reduced lexical alignment in ASD in an unstructured discourse context. Moreover, positive associations between lexical alignment and task performance in the neurotypical group raise the possibility that interventions to promote the use of shared vocabulary might support better communication.

摘要

目的

典型的说话者倾向于采用对话伙伴使用的词汇。这种“词汇对齐”通过减少歧义并促进对讨论主题的共同理解来增强沟通。迄今为止,在自闭症谱系障碍 (ASD) 中,词汇对齐的研究很少;此外,主要通过可能高估表现的结构化实验室任务进行研究。本研究在话语中检查了 ASD 中的词汇对齐,并探讨了与交际成功和执行功能的关联。

方法

31 名自闭症和非自闭症青少年与一名研究新手研究助理 (RA) 配对,完成一项涉及轮流口头指导 (引导) 伙伴在地图上导航的社交沟通任务。词汇对齐的操作性定义为指南在连续地图上生成的共享词汇的比例。任务准确性的操作性定义为包含在预期和绘制路线内的像素。

结果

结果表明,自闭症青少年更难以向 RA 描述导航路线,导致路径准确性降低。自闭症参与者的对齐度降低,与非自闭症参与者的路径准确性相关,但与自闭症参与者无关。词汇对齐与执行功能之间的关联未达到显著水平(=.05);如果有意义,该关联将表明执行功能困难越大,词汇对齐程度越低。

结论

这些发现为 ASD 中在非结构化话语环境中词汇对齐减少提供了初步证据。此外,在神经典型组中,词汇对齐与任务表现之间的正相关关系提出了这样一种可能性,即促进使用共享词汇的干预措施可能会支持更好的沟通。
